Grammar Guru Tip #22. Think of "nor" as "or" for negative sentences, and it's not optional. Use "nor" before the second or farther of two alternatives when "neither" introduces the first. Example: Neither my mother nor I understand these directions. Pro tip: You can also use "nor" with a negative first clause or a sentence including "not."
